Everyone uses clichés while writing. However, if you use them too often, your writing becomes trite and uninteresting. This tool helps you avoid exactly that.

The checker uses a unique algorithm that marks any overused and stale phrases in your writing. Making changes based on these suggestions is completely up to you, but it’s certainly important to identify patterns in your writing.

The tool isn’t restricted to essays and can be used to identify clichés in any form of writing. Just upload your text on the web page and you’re good to go!

Perfect citations are key to scoring well on academic writing tests. There are methods to cite sources in academic essays, like APA , MLA , or Chicago . These citation styles follow different rules, and you can’t afford to fumble between them.

Citation Machine is a quick, time-efficient tool to generate citations in your desired style format. It allows you to create citations in more than 7000 styles, and also keeps a record of your entries. So, once you’re done citing all your sources, you also get a ready bibliography!

For its paid plans, the tool offers a plagiarism check, expert help on your essays, and other useful features. It’s certainly a great tool for any essay writer!

Developed by writer Keith Blount (about 14 years ago), this is what a tailor-made author’s app looks like.

Scrivener is the full package as far as book writing is concerned. It has features that make it a combination of a typewriter, ring binder, and a scrapbook.

It is equipped with all the features to take your book or any other long-form writing from conception to the last full stop of your draft. It comes with features such as the corkboard, outliner, inspector, pre-set formatting, templates, file importing, metatags, automated document listing, and many other important book writing features.

Scrivener is perfect for writers in many genres; for example, it can be used by novelists, scriptwriters, academics, lawyers, translators, journalists, and students.

Supported Systems : macOS, iOS, and Windows.

Pricing: Scrivener has 4 pricing plans. Scrivener for macOS is at $49, iOS costs $19.99 ,  Scrivener for Windows costs $45, and the bundled plan for both macOS and Windows, which is $80.

Best App for Academic Assignments

Manuscript is a tool that is perfect for students and academics.  

And the good thing is that it works with popular word processing apps, including Microsoft Word.

Whether it’s an essay, lab report, dissertation, or a literature review, Manuscript will take you from the planning stage to the last page.

One of the reasons why Manuscript is an excellent tool for academic writing is its citation features. The tool allows you to import your reference library from reference management software such as Zotero and Mendeley. You can also cite directly with popular reference management systems, including Bookends and F1000Workspace.

It also has essential writing features like the outliner, the inspectors, focus mode, and you also have an option of switching to a full-screen mode.

Even with all these capabilities, Manuscript has a simple UI and is very easy to use.

21. yWriter

Attribute: For Authors Who Like Crafting their Novel Scene by Scene

yWriter used to be an exclusive Windows book writing app, but they have made it available on almost all the major platforms—Windows, Android, iOS, and macOS (which is still a beta version).

yWriter is similar to Scrivener and I remember back then, some people said it was “a Scrivener for Windows.” But unlike Scrivener, yWriter focuses on chapters and separates them as if they were different books.

In those chapters, you can then set up scenes. So, each chapter is treated as an independent section, and the scenes can be sorted separately in different windows.

Once you hit a dead end, you can mark the scene as unused and it won’t be included in the final word count.

yWriter has features for adding scenes, characters, locations, etc.

The app also helps you track your progress by displaying word counts (per file and the total) and keeping everyday log files.

Supported Systems : Windows, Android, iOS, & macOS.

Price: Free

For most of human history, writing tools were pretty basic. While there were important advances in technology such as the invention of paper, the printing press, and later the typewriter, it was all just physical marks on a physical medium at the end of the day.

Word processing software was a huge leap forward, forever changing the process of drafting and archiving. The core technology of word processing has remained more or less the same even into the 21st century, but we have seen major advances in the organizational and brainstorming tools available to writers.

The result is our current landscape, in which hundreds (if not thousands) of writing apps compete for your attention, all claiming to revolutionize the way you write.

Which apps are worth your time? This article will help you decide, exploring a variety of writing apps to improve the way you brainstorm, draft, edit, and publish your work.

Whether you’re a student, knowledge worker, or professional writer, you’ll find something useful below.

Overview: A digital mind-mapping tool that’s great for brainstorming.

Mind-mapping is a powerful tool for brainstorming writing and drawing connections between ideas. Traditionally, the technique involves drawing shapes on paper and connecting those shapes with branching lines.

These days, however, you aren’t confined to making paper mind maps. Coggle lets you create digital mind maps that are saved to the cloud and accessible across devices. And unlike on paper, you can edit and rearrange the mind maps as much as you want without worrying about running out of space.

If you’re struggling to come up with writing ideas, then Coggle could be the creative boost you need.

Price: A free version is available with up to 3 private mind maps (and unlimited public ones). The paid version starts at $5 / month and includes unlimited private mind maps, extra shapes, and additional formatting options.

Platforms: Web

Cold Turkey Writer

Cold Turkey Writer app interface

Overview: If you’re procrastinating on a writing project, Cold Turkey Writer will force you to focus.

Your computer is a powerful tool for writing, but it also includes lots of potential distractions such as social media, video games, Netflix, and Wikipedia rabbit holes. Cold Turkey Writer eliminates these distractions.

When you launch the app, you tell it your writing goal. This goal can be either a number of words or an amount of time spent writing. After you’ve done that, Cold Turkey will block every app on your computer (internet included) until you’ve met your writing goal.

This might seem extreme, but that’s why it’s so effective. When you remove other options, you’ll be amazed how much writing you produce.

Note that while Cold Turkey Writer is an excellent tool for producing distraction-free drafts, it doesn’t include many formatting options. So you’ll need to use it in conjunction with an app like Google Docs or Microsoft Word if you plan to print or publish your writing.

Price: Most features are free. A one-time payment of $9 (CAD) will get you additional formatting and theming features.

Platforms: Mac, Windows

Overview: A popular tool for long-form writing projects such as novels, screenplays, and dissertations.

Long-form writing presents unique challenges compared to writing essays, blog posts, or other short pieces. One of the main challenges is organization. How do you keep track of what you’ve written? And how do you arrange your writing into a cohesive whole?

Scrivener aims to solve these problems. It includes all the standard word processing features you’d find in an app like Word or Docs, but it also includes features for organizing, navigating, and editing your writing projects.

You can quickly see all your project’s chapters, sections, or scenes at a glance. And you can quickly rearrange these items to help you put together your final manuscript.

Other handy features include:

  • A virtual “corkboard” to help you plan your writing structure
  • The ability to split documents into smaller chapters or sections
  • Tools for displaying reference material such as images, PDFs, or web pages (without having to leave the Scrivener app).
  • Options for exporting your work as a PDF, Word Doc, or even a Kindle ebook.

Price: One-time purchase of $49 for a single desktop license (Mac or Windows). Students and academics can receive a discounted license for $41.65. The iOS app requires a separate purchase of $19.99. A 30-day free trial is also available.

Platforms: Mac, Windows, iOS

Overview: Aimed at novel writers, Novlr includes extensive tools to organize and track your long-form writing projects.

At first glance, Novlr seems similar to Scrivener. And while the two apps do share a lot of features in common, Novlr is different enough that it’s also worth considering.

To start, there’s the Novlr interface. Compared to Scrivener, it’s much more minimalist. However, don’t mistake this minimalism for a lack of features and power.

Novlr lets you see an overview of your writing sections and chapters as you work, and it constantly saves your writing (much like Google Docs). There’s also a “Focus Mode” that hides the interface so you can concentrate on the current chapter or section.

Most of the above features are available in Scrivener. Where Novlr really stands out is in its style and grammar checking features.

As you write, Novlr will show you suggestions for fixing grammar, spelling, and even making your writing more concise. And unlike a lot of writing apps that only mark errors or suggest corrections, Novlr includes explanations for each of its suggestions. This way, you can learn to be a better writer as you use the app.

Overall, I think Novlr is a better tool if you’re focused on novel or fiction writing, while Scrivener is better if you plan to write nonfiction. Scrivener’s tools for organization and research material are superior to Novlr’s, while Novlr is hyper-focused on being the best tool for novelists (and no one else).

Ultimately, both apps have free trials, so I encourage you to test out each and see which is better for your long-form writing needs.

Price: $100 per year or $10 month-to-month. A 2-week free trial is also available.

Platforms: Web (also works offline and on mobile devices)

Overview: A simple Markdown writing app.

Byword is a Markdown text editor that aims to help you write faster. If you’re not familiar with Markdown, here’s a good explanation . Basically, it’s a way to write plain text that you can then quickly convert into HTML (saving you the hassle of manually writing HTML).

If that last paragraph made your eyes glaze over, don’t worry; there are plenty of other apps in this article for your needs. But if you regularly write for the web, learning Markdown (and using a Markdown editor such as Byword) can save you a lot of time.

Byword lets you write documents in Markdown and then export them as HTML, Rich Text, or a PDF. You can also export your writing directly to a publishing platform such as WordPress, Medium, Blogger, or Tumblr. If you already use Markdown (or want to learn it), then Byword is a tool you should look into.

Price: One-time purchase of $10.99 (Mac app) or $5.99 (iPhone and iPad app)

Platforms: Mac, iOS

Overview: A private, online journal that helps you build a daily writing habit.

“Write every day” is a common New Year’s Resolution, but it can be tricky to stick to. If you’re looking for an app to help motivate you, check out 750 Words .

As the name implies, 750 Words is an app that helps you build a habit of writing at least 750 words (about 3 pages) per day. When you log in to the app, you’ll see nothing but a place to write. As you type, the app keeps track of your progress and lets you know when you’ve passed 750 words. The app also saves your work so you can review it later, and everything is completely private.

In addition to the writing features, 750 Words shows you insights about your writing such as how many days in a row you’ve written, your average words per minute, and the mood you were in (based on the words you use).

Whether you’re looking to write as a creative exercise, to learn more about yourself, or because some stranger on the internet like me told you to, 750 Words is a great way to get your thoughts onto the page.

Price: Free for 30 days, then $5 / month.

Overview: An app that checks (and automatically corrects) your grammar, spelling, and more.

The school system generally does a terrible job of teaching grammar. Combine that with the fact that English spelling is an illogical disaster, and it’s no wonder that we all struggle with writing “mechanics” to one degree or another.

The grammar and spell check tools in your word processor can help, but they still miss a lot of mistakes. This is where Grammarly comes in.

Grammarly checks your writing for mistakes in spelling, grammar, and usage. When it finds a mistake, it will highlight it and explain what’s wrong. You can then choose to accept the correction or ignore it.

To get the most out of Grammarly, I recommend installing the browser extension . With this, Grammarly will automatically check your writing everywhere from your email to Google Docs to online forms. Prefer to write offline? Grammarly also has standalone apps that you can paste your writing into, as well as extensions for Microsoft Word.

Even as a professional writer and editor with a degree in English, I use Grammarly every day. It speeds up the editing process and finds mistakes that spell check tends to miss. While its suggestions aren’t correct 100% of the time, it’s still a valuable tool for any kind of writing (except maybe poetry).

Price: All the features I described above are free. You can upgrade to Premium for $29.95 / month to get additional features such as vocabulary suggestions, plagiarism checks, and readability suggestions.

Platforms: Android, iOS, Mac, Windows, Web. Browser extensions are available for Chrome, Safari, Firefox, and Edge. A Microsoft Word extension is also available.

Overview: An app that helps you make your writing easier to read.

When you’re writing a draft, the thoughts often come out of your head in a jumble. During the editing process, it’s your job to make this jumble understandable. To help you out, I recommend the Hemingway app .

Hemingway’s goal is to remove anything unnecessary from your writing. This could be complex sentences, passive voice, adverbs, or big words. While none of these are “wrong” to use, removing them often makes your writing easier to read.

Whenever Hemingway encounters something it thinks you should remove, it will highlight it. Next to each highlight, you’ll see a suggestion for improvement. This could be anything from using a simpler word to shortening a lengthy sentence.

In addition to stylistic suggestions, Hemingway also displays some useful statistics about your writing, including readability, word count, and estimated reading time.

If you purchase the desktop version of Hemingway, you’ll get additional features such as the ability to publish directly to WordPress or Medium and the option to export your writing as HTML, Markdown, Word Doc, or PDF.

For maximum editing power, combine Hemingway with Grammarly.

Price: Web version is free. Desktop versions (Mac and Windows) are each $19.99.

Platforms: Mac, Windows, Web

Overview: A free tool for organizing academic sources and generating citations.

When you’re writing a thesis, dissertation, or research paper , it can be tricky to keep track of your sources. You could keep a list of them in a text document, but that relies on you remembering to update it. And when it’s time to cite your sources, it could take hours to assemble that list into a properly formatted bibliography.

To make it easier to manage your research, use Zotero . Zotero is an open-source app for collecting, organizing, and citing sources of all kinds.

Once you’ve installed the Zotero browser extension , you can quickly pull citation information from library pages, JSTOR, online journals, and just about any other digital source you can think of. The result is a database of sources that you can quickly search and reference.

And when it’s time to submit your final draft, Zotero can generate a bibliography or references section in the citation format of your choice (APA, Chicago, MLA, and thousands more ). The app also includes tools for collaborating on papers with other researchers, and you have the option to store all your Zotero data in the cloud.

Platforms: Mac, Windows, Linux, Chrome, Firefox, Safari

The U.S. Surgeon General called for social media companies to be required to use safety warning labels in a New York Times opinion essay published Monday.

Citing research that shows social media could be negatively impacting youth mental health , Dr. Vivek H. Murthy said a surgeon general's warning on social media platforms, similar to those on tobacco and alcohol products, could raise awareness for parents about the potential harm of the platforms.

"One of the worst things for a parent is to know your children are in danger yet be unable to do anything about it," Murthy wrote. "That is how parents tell me they feel when it comes to social media — helpless and alone in the face of toxic content and hidden harms."

NetChoice , a trade organization representing some social media companies, said in a statement shared with USA TODAY that the responsibility should be on the parents to protect their children's mental health, not the government or tech companies.

Research shows social media could come with benefit and harm

Murthy said social media is a major factor in the mental health crisis among young people, which he called "an emergency."

Social media has become nearly ubiquitous among youth. The  2023 U.S. Surgeon General's Advisory on Social Media and Youth Mental Health  found that nearly  95% of youth aged 13 to 17 use a social media platform , with more than a third saying they use it "almost constantly."

The advisory concluded that more research is needed to fully understand the impacts of social media. But it showed there are some benefits and "ample indicators that social media can also have a profound risk of harm to the mental health and well-being of children and adolescents."

Potential benefits identified in the advisory were community, connection and self expression. It also stated that social media can support mental health of LGBTQ youth to help develop their identities. Additionally, seven out of 10 girls of color reported encountering identity-affirming content related to race on social media, the advisory stated.

Potential harms of using social media included greater risk of suffering from depression and anxiety. Some studies also showed greater risk of negative health outcomes for adolescents girls including disordered eating and poor sleep.

Murthy praises dairy recall, Boeing response as examples of swift action

In the NYT letter, Murthy pointed to the F.A.A.'s swift grounding of Boeing 737 MAX 9 planes after a door plug came off mid-flight earlier this year and widespread recalls of cheese products due to risk of listeria contamination .

"Why is it that we have failed to respond to the harms of social media when they are no less urgent or widespread than those posed by unsafe cars, planes or food?," Murthy wrote. "These harms are not a failure of willpower and parenting; they are the consequence of unleashing powerful technology without adequate safety measures, transparency or accountability."

Several state bills seeking to limit youth access to social media have been passed by legislatures but blocked in court. Those lawsuits were often brought by NetChoice.

NetChoice vice president and general counsel Carl Szabo said in a statement that the onus is on parents to protect their children from harm online.

"A warning label oversimplifies this issue, and it is a simplistic way to approach this that assumes that every child is the exact same. In reality, every child is different and struggles with their own challenges," Szabo said. "Parents and guardians are the most appropriately situated to handle these unique needs of their children—not the government or tech companies."
